Simple interface, serious security

SEED VAULT follows exactly the same flow as on the device screen: PIN, passphrase, 2FA, then access to your seed slots. No online account, no cloud, no automatic sync.

It is designed as a standalone safe: configure it once, store it in a secure place, and power it on only when you need your sensitive information.

Key features

  • Up to 15 seed slots, each with a custom name.
  • Support for 12 or 24 words per seed.
  • Built-in TOTP 2FA (Google Authenticator compatible QR).
  • Encrypted Bluetooth cloning between SEED VAULT devices.
  • Secure full wipe (ERASE ALL) directly from the UI.

Security architecture

SEED VAULT is built to minimize the attack surface. Everything revolves around three layers: PIN, passphrase, 2FA.

1. 8-digit PIN

Access starts with an 8-digit PIN. After several wrong attempts, the device can wipe itself to protect against brute-force attacks.

2. Passphrase

A passphrase complements the PIN. It is entered via a virtual keyboard on the device touchscreen and never leaves the hardware.

3. TOTP 2FA

A TOTP code is generated locally from a secret displayed once as a QR code during setup. No external backend is required.

Secure wipe (ERASE ALL)

A repeated gesture on the UI (the triangular “ERASE ALL” area) can wipe all data from NVS and reboot the device as factory-fresh.

Secure device-to-device cloning

The BLE cloning module lets you export or import seeds and settings between two SEED VAULT units using a pairing code. No server is involved: communication is direct and encrypted.

Hardware & firmware

Platform

SEED VAULT is built on an ESP32 board with a color touch display and NVS/flash for encrypted secret storage.

User interface

The firmware UI uses large high-contrast buttons (SEEDS, OPTIONS, CLONE, etc.), a dark background, light text and a green accent for validated actions – exactly like this site theme.

Firmware for integrators

The code is structured into clear modules: auth, seeds, clone, lights, wifi_time, etc. It is meant to be readable, maintainable and extensible.

Frequently asked questions

Does SEED VAULT connect to the Internet?
No. The device is designed to remain fully offline. Wi-Fi, if enabled, is only used for time sync or explicitly configured features.
What if I lose the device?
Without PIN, passphrase and 2FA, access to the data is extremely difficult. Depending on configuration, multiple failed attempts can trigger a full wipe.
Can I rename my seeds?
Yes. Each slot (SEED 01, SEED 02, etc.) can be given a custom name directly on the device screen. The site mirrors this notion of “named slots”.
How do I update the firmware?
Updates are done via USB/UART flashing with ESP-IDF / esptool. No forced OTA auto-updates.
